Evening Embers 001 - The Road Behind You

Beginning the pilgrimage by surrendering the day already traveled.

“Search me, O God, and know my heart: try me, and know my thoughts.”

Psalm 139:23

THE EMBER

The first evening of a pilgrimage isn’t the time to measure how far you’ve traveled.

It’s the time to turn around and look honestly at the road behind you.

Not every step was faithful. Some were hurried. Some were taken because fear pressed against your back. Some paths looked wise when you entered them but left you farther from peace. There were places where you resisted God, places where you mistook your own urgency for His direction, and places where grace carried you while you were too exhausted to recognize it.

None of this disqualifies you from the road ahead.

The psalmist didn’t ask God to search him because he believed nothing would be found. He invited the examination because he trusted the One doing the searching.

God doesn’t reveal the heart merely to accuse it. He brings hidden things into the light so they no longer have to govern us from the darkness.

Tonight, don’t defend the journey.

Don’t rewrite it.

Don’t condemn yourself for it.

Let the Lord walk with you through the ground you’ve already crossed. Ask Him to show you where pride led, where fear decided, where obedience cost you something, and where His mercy quietly preserved you.

The road behind you isn’t wasted ground.

Even your failures can become landmarks when they teach you where not to build again.

RELEASE

Release the need to make every past decision appear justified.

Release the shame that says one wrong turn has defined the whole journey.

Release the fear that you’ve wandered too far for God to redirect you.

The Shepherd knows how to find His people on roads they were never meant to take.

EVENING PRAYER

Father, search me without allowing me to hide behind excuses or collapse beneath shame. Show me the truth about the road I have traveled. Reveal where I followed fear, pride, appetite, or impatience. Remind me also of the places where Your grace sustained me and Your hand protected me.

I give You every wrong turn, every unfinished mile, and every step I still don’t understand.

Teach me from the road behind me, but do not let me live facing backward.

Lead me forward in peace.

In the name of Jesus, amen.

BENEDICTION

May the God who witnessed every mile redeem the ground behind you, steady the ground beneath you, and illuminate the next faithful step before you.
